Directions from Chicago
If you are traveling from Chicago, the best way to reach Oswego is by car. It is approximately 50 miles southwest of downtown Chicago. The easiest route is to take I-290 West towards I-88 West. From there, take the exit for IL-59 South towards Plainfield/Naperville. Continue on IL-59 for approximately 10 miles until you reach Oswego. Alternatively, you can take the Metra BNSF Railway Line from Chicago's Union Station. Take the train heading towards Aurora and get off at the Aurora Transportation Center. From there, take the Route 524 Pace bus towards Yorkville. Get off at the Oswego Park and Ride, and you will be in the heart of Oswego.

3. Little White School Museum
The Little White School Museum is a historic schoolhouse that has been converted into a museum. It features exhibits on the history of Oswego and the surrounding area, including the town's early settlers and its role in the Underground Railroad. The museum is a great place to learn about the town's rich history and to experience what life was like in the 19th century.
